Title 42 › Chapter CHAPTER 2— - SANITATION AND QUARANTINE › § 90
When cargo is unloaded away from the port of entry, the collector must place it in warehouses or enclosures he designates. The goods stay there at the owners' risk and are kept jointly by the collector and the owner or master until unloaded and safe to remove without violating health laws. Then the collector may let owners or agents take entered, duties‑paid goods after paying a reasonable storage fee set by the HHS Secretary.
